The Nepal Military Fixed Wing Aircraft Market is relatively small compared to other countries, with a fleet primarily consisting of transport and utility aircraft for logistics and troop transport purposes. The Nepalese Army Air Service operates a limited number of fixed-wing aircraft, including Dornier Do 228 and Harbin Y-12 for reconnaissance and transport missions. The market for military fixed-wing aircraft in Nepal is characterized by a focus on ruggedness and versatility to operate in challenging mountainous terrain and provide essential support for remote regions. While the market is not large in terms of scale, there is a growing demand for modernization and capability enhancement to meet evolving security challenges, potentially leading to opportunities for suppliers of specialized fixed-wing aircraft and related support services in the future.

The Nepal Military Fixed Wing Aircraft Market faces several challenges, including limited financial resources for procurement and maintenance, aging fleet leading to increased operational costs and decreased efficiency, lack of infrastructure and facilities for aircraft maintenance and operations, and dependency on foreign aid for acquiring advanced aircraft technology and training. Additionally, the geographical terrain and weather conditions in Nepal pose challenges for operating fixed-wing aircraft effectively. The need for modernization and upgrades to enhance capabilities and meet evolving security threats also presents a significant challenge in the Nepal Military Fixed Wing Aircraft Market. Overcoming these challenges will require strategic planning, increased investment, and collaboration with international partners for technical support and training programs.
